AB Contern overpowered Avanti Mondorf 101-67 in the M-U18 Division 5 Phase finale round-robin, building control early and never letting go. After a brief 6-7 deficit, Contern uncorked a 16-0 run to 22-7, fueled by Emil Dostert's relentless scoring inside and mid-range touches. Contern closed the first quarter up 27-14 and stretched the gap again in the second: once Mondorf pulled to 33-20, the hosts answered with a 12-0 burst to 45-20, highlighted by triples from Niels Daniel Keane and Alexandre Lopes Meysembourg.
The third quarter sealed it (34-15), with Alex Wies and Tao Tock piling on before Efe Denizlerkurdu (Season PPG: 16.83) caught fire from deep. Contern's largest lead hit 45 points (90-45) early in the fourth, a stretch that included back-to-back threes by Denizlerkurdu, who later added another for emphasis. Mondorf showed late resistance and took the final period 24-20.
Top performers
- Contern: Efe Denizlerkurdu (18, TUR) led with 25 points and five triples, closing the game in style. Dostert added 14 (11 in the first quarter), Lopes Meysembourg (CON) 14, Tock (CON) 12 and Wies 11. Damian Ioannis Xirouchakis (1.76m) opened the scoring and chipped in across the middle quarters.
- Mondorf: Arthur Ladonet (16, FRA) poured in 34, a lone constant for the visitors and including a hot stretch with back-to-back threes in the fourth. Daniel Mihaylov (Season PPG: 10.0) added 14; Elizon Herring had 6 and Aleksa Savic 5.
Coach Anthony Franck Tomba's team used multiple momentum punches 16-0 in the first, 12-0 in the second, and a dominant third quarter to decide the contest early. Contern are on a three-game winning streak. Coach Nebojsa Nikolic's Mondorf couldn't build on their recent win, despite Ladonet's standout night and a late push.
